r/postgresql-server: Set become on postgres tasks
Tasks that must run as the _postgres_ user need to explicity enable `become`, in case it is not already enabled at the playbook level. This can happen, for example, when the playbook is running directly as root.dynamic-inventory
parent
2d5f9e66c1
commit
0048a87630
|
@ -27,6 +27,7 @@
|
|||
- user
|
||||
|
||||
- name: ensure postgres-exporter postgresql role exists
|
||||
become: true
|
||||
become_user: postgres
|
||||
postgresql_user:
|
||||
name: postgres-exporter
|
||||
|
@ -34,6 +35,7 @@
|
|||
tags:
|
||||
- pguser
|
||||
- name: ensure postgres-exporter postgresql is in pg_monitor group
|
||||
become: true
|
||||
become_user: postgres
|
||||
postgresql_membership:
|
||||
groups:
|
||||
|
|
Loading…
Reference in New Issue